Part I. Bioventing Pilot Test Work Plan for POL Storage Area C, Tinker AFB, Oklahoma. Part II. Draft Interim Pilot Test Results Report for POL Storage Area C, Tinker AFB, Oklahoma

Abstract

This work plan presents the scope of an in situ bioventing pilot test for treatment of fuel-contaminated soils at Petroleum, Oils, and Lubricants (POL) Storage Area C at Tinker Air Force Base (AFB), Oklahoma. The pilot test has three primary objectives: 1) to assess the potential for supplying oxygen throughout the contaminated soil interval, 2) to determine the rate at which indigenous microorganisms will degrade fuel when stimulated by oxygen-rich soil gas, and 3) to evaluate the potential for sustaining these rates of biodegradation until fuel contamination is remediated to concentrations below regulatory standards. The pilot test will be conducted in two phases. A vent well (VW) and monitoring points (MPs) will be installed during site investigation activities. The initial stage will also include an in situ respiration test and an air permeability test. This initial testing is expected to take approximately 2 weeks. During the second phase, a bioventing system will be installed and monitored over a 1-year period. If bioventing proves to be feasible at this site, pilot test data could be used to design a full-scale remediation system and to estimate the time required for site cleanup. An added benefit of the pilot testing at POL Storage Area C is that a significant amount of the fuel contamination should be biodegraded during the 1- year pilot test, as the testing will take place within the most contaminated soils at the site.
